Nomenclatural details

Frankliniella pulchella Hood, 1935: 163.

Biology and Distribution

Described from Barro Colorado Island, Panama. Recorded on Cydista aequinoctalis, Arrabidea verrucosa, Phryganocydia corymbosa and Clitoria javitensis flowers. Recorded from Costa Rica on Bignoniaceous flowers.

Type information

Holotype, National Museum of Natural History, Smithsonian Institution, Washington DC.
